New release: LightningChart Python 2.1

LightningChart Python is a GPU-accelerated and WebGL-rendered plotting library for Python that introduces version 2.1, with important new features that will enhance your Python applications. Here's a summary:

Introducing DataGrid

Introducing a new high-performance DataGrid component to present metrics, KPIs, and mini-trends right inside a grid.

Container

This new version introduces the Container feature that enables scrollable multi-chart layouts with custom dimensions.

LegendPanel

The Legend Panel feature allows you to create dedicated legend areas inside dashboards and containers, push entries from series, add text boxes, and control visuals.

Other features & improvements

  • Heatmap min-max aggregation
  • Heatmap/3D Surface contours
  • New event listener methods
  • New TranslateCoordinate system
  • Drill-down method for TreeMap charts
